=== Current Status Maledictum===
In battles with the [[Daemon Prince]] imprisoned inside the [[Maledictum]], and with renegade [[Chapter Master]] [[Azariah Kyras]], Angelos lost his right eye, his left arm and both his legs{{Fn|3}}{{Fn|4}}.
After defeating Kyras, Angelos's broken body was lifted from the debris by Captain [[Apollo Diomedes]]. Angelos recovered, with the aid of [[augmetics]] to replace his lost limbs and eye, and was hailed as the Blood Ravens' new Chapter Master{{Fn|4}}.
 
===Acheron===
On the world of [[Acheron]], the Imperium, Orks, and Eldar would all come to blows while fighting over a catastrophic weapon known as the [[Spear of Khaine]]. The Blood Angels under Angelos arrived, running an Inquisitorial blockade to aid Imperial [[Knight]] forces under Lady [[Solaria]]. During the battle on Acheron, Angelos battled both [[Biel-Tan]] Eldar and [[Gorgutz]]' Orks.{{Fn|7}}
 
After tracking Gorgutz's forces to The Vault containing the Spear, Angelos is caught in an Inquisition orbital bombardment that intended to destroy the device but instead opened the vault it was sealed in. However he survives, and leads an attack on the Temple of the Spear of Khaine that overruns both the Eldar and Ork forces. When they come to the Spear they instead find a trap that frees a [[Bloodthirster]] and its Daemonic hordes. Desperate, Angelos has the [[Battle Barge]] ''[[The Dauntless]]'' collide with a fissure in Acheron's surface to prevent the Daemonic infestation from spreading. Angelos was able to teleport to safety before the planet was destroyed.{{Fn|7}}
